Ethernet Connection

Ethernet Link

The rear panel Ethernet connector on the ISS 506 can be connected to an Ethernet LAN or WAN. This connection makes SIS control of the switcher possible using a computer connected to the same LAN.

LAN

LINK ACT

Ethernet connection

The Ethernet cable can be terminated as a straight-through cable or a crossover cable and must be properly terminated for your application (figure A-1).

Crossover cable — Direct connection between the computer and the ISS 506.

Patch (straight) cable — Connection of the ISS 506 to an Ethernet LAN.

A cable that is wired as T568A at one end and T568B at the other (Tx and Rx pairs reversed) is a "crossover" cable.

A cable wired the same at both ends is called a "straight-through" cable, because no pin/pair assignments are swapped.

Default address

To access the ISS 506 via the LAN port, you need the switcher’s IP address. If the address has been changed to an address comprised of words and characters, the actual numeric IP address can be determined using the Ping utility. If the address has not been changed, the factory-specified default is 192.168.254.254.

Ping can also be used to test the Ethernet link to the ISS 506.

Ping to determine Extron IP address

The Microsoft Ping utility is available at the DOS prompt. Ping tests the Ethernet interface between the computer and the ISS 506. Ping can also be used to determine the actual numeric IP address from an alias and to determine the Web address.
